    Let \(p\) be a prime. The authors consider groups \(G\) with modular Sylow \(p\)-subgroup \(S\) and show for this class that \(p\)-nilpotency of \(G\) and \(N_G(S)\) imply each other. Also, \(p\)-subgroups that are permutable with all Sylow subgroups are permutable with all subgroups if \(S\) is modular. If all Sylow subgroups are modular, permutability with all Sylow subgroups implies permutability with all subgroups (Theorems 1 and 2). Implications are given concerning group classes near to PST-groups.
